Sarri will not be Chelsea coach next season but Abramovich is the real problem. You can't just keep hiring and firing coaches and expect to win all the time. He had a top manager in Conte and fired him 1 year after he won Chelsea the league.

Also, Abramovich needs to understand the dynamics are different. City and Liverpool are at their peak and knocking them off their throne won't happen overnight. He needs to bring in a manager and give him 3 years to buy his players and instil his philosophy on the club. This is one of the weakest sides Abramovich has had as owner and simply replacing the manager won't cut it with the likes of City, Pool, and United looking to win at all costs.

It'll be an interesting summer with potentially both United and Chelsea looking to hire new managers.
